The Most Well-Known Story about Rabbi Zusya* of Hanipol
On the last day of his life, Zusya was on his deathbed. He began to cry uncontrollably & his students and disciples tried hard to comfort him. They asked him, “Rabbi, why do you weep? You are almost as wise as Moses, you are almost as hospitable as Abraham, & surely heaven will judge you favorably.”
Zusya answered them: “It is true. When I get to heaven, I won’t worry so much if God asks me, ‘Zusya, why were you not more like Abraham?’ or ‘Zusya, why were you not more like Moses?’ I know I would be able to answer these questions. After all, I was not given the righteousness of Abraham or the faith of Moses but I tried to be both hospitable & thoughtful. But if God asks me ‘Zusya, why were you not more like Zusya?’, I will have no answer."

This is incompetence on Trump's part...guess we shouldn't be surprised. A tariff is an economic tool that should not be used indiscriminately or as a bludgeon. There are situations where tariffs are justified, mostly for protection of fledgling domestic industries until they're developed enough to compete with their foreign equivalents. That is not the case here. Trump's hard-core base loves it, no doubt...no one with any knowledge of economics would consider this a good move.
This will restart the trade war with China, & likely start a new one with Mexico. (I dunno what Canada will do, as Trudeau's abdicated the throne) The CCP will impose tariffs in turn but selectively in order to hurt our exports while keeping their manufacturing safe, as they did during Trump's first term.
Also - tariffs are inflationary, especially when imposed for too long. JPow & co. know it, which is why the Federal Reserve has stopped reducing the official interest rate...depending on what happens this year & next, the Fed might even start ratcheting up the rate again.
My take: I think it's a good time to buy bonds now, & diversify in assets other than stocks & ETFs. The markets will continue to rise in the long run, but in 2025 & '26 I expect them to be fairly rocky. Unless you're a pro or exceptionally cool-headed, you might want to sit this one out.
